Cradled by the Kirishima mountain range on a plateau about twelve hundred meters high, Ebino Kogen Onsen wells up amid the peaks. Ebino Kogen lies in the southeast of Ebino City in Miyazaki Prefecture, a basin like plateau ringed by summits such as Karakunidake, Shiratoriyama, and Koshikidake. This mountain spa lets you enjoy the earth given gifts of volcanic activity together with wonderfully clear air.

Highlights

From the baths of the plateau lodgings you can view the ridgeline of Karakunidake, which changes its expression with the seasons. Around you spread the rugged slopes of Mount Iwo and scattered crater lakes such as Fudoike, Rokkannon Miike, and Byakushiike, with a nature trail laid out to tour them. Sinking into an open air bath, you feel the cool breeze that comes with the high elevation drift pleasantly past. Ebino Kogen sits within Kirishima Kinkowan National Park, a place where you can feel the workings of the earth up close.

Enjoying the Seasons

In early summer the plateau blushes pale crimson with Miyama Kirishima azaleas, drawing many hikers. Summer brings people seeking a cool retreat, and autumn tints the grasslands and woods in gold. In winter a bath while gazing at snow dusted Karakunidake is exceptional, with the hushed plateau spring waiting quietly.

Access and Basic Information

A car is convenient, climbing Prefectural Route 1 up to the plateau from the Ebino interchange on the Kyushu Expressway. It sits near the trailhead for Karakunidake and is beloved as a spring to visit before or after a climb. On the plateau there are the Ebino Eco Museum Center and a free foot bath, handy as a rest base. Some facilities also welcome day visitors.

A Quick Tip

The plateau is markedly cooler than the lowlands, and even in summer mornings and evenings turn chilly. Bringing something to layer on gives peace of mind. If you pair it with a hike, a soak after descending eases the tiredness before you head home.

Practical Travel Notes

Ebino Kogen Onsen is a mountain spring welling up on a plateau about twelve hundred meters high in Ebino City, Miyazaki Prefecture. Ebino Kogen is a basin like plateau ringed by peaks such as Karakunidake, Shiratoriyama, and Koshikidake, with a nature trail touring the still active volcanic Mount Iwo and crater lakes such as Fudoike, Rokkannon Miike, and Byakushiike. It lies within Kirishima Kinkowan National Park and is known as a main trailhead for Karakunidake. The hot springs center on plateau lodgings, and whether day bathing is available along with its fees and hours varies by facility, so checking in advance is wise. Access is basically by car, climbing Prefectural Route 1 from the Ebino interchange on the Kyushu Expressway. On the plateau the Ebino Eco Museum Center and a free foot bath are handy for a rest and for gathering information. The elevation is high and cooler than the lowlands, so prepare a layer to slip on even in summer.
